How to fill out meeting called to orderopening

How to fill out meeting called to orderopening
01
To fill out a meeting called to order/opening, follow these steps:
02
Begin by stating the purpose of the meeting and introducing yourself as the person who is calling the meeting to order.
03
Greet the attendees and thank them for coming.
04
Clearly outline the agenda and objectives of the meeting to ensure everyone is on the same page.
05
Set ground rules for the meeting, such as speaking order, time limits, and any other guidelines that need to be followed.
06
Start the meeting by addressing the first item on the agenda and provide any necessary background information or context.
07
Encourage active participation from attendees by inviting questions, comments, or suggestions related to the topic being discussed.
08
Keep the meeting focused and on track, ensuring that all agenda items are addressed within the allocated time.
09
Summarize key points or decisions made during the meeting and outline any action steps that need to be taken.
10
Before adjourning the meeting, check if there are any outstanding questions or concerns from the participants.
11
Thank everyone for their time and contributions, and officially declare the meeting adjourned.
12
Remember to be well-prepared, organized, and respectful throughout the meeting process.

What is meeting called to order/opening?
A meeting called to order/opening is the official start of a meeting where the chairperson declares the meeting open.
Who is required to file meeting called to order/opening?
The chairperson or presiding officer of the meeting is usually responsible for calling the meeting to order/opening.
How to fill out meeting called to order/opening?
To fill out a meeting called to order/opening, the chairperson needs to officially start the meeting by welcoming participants and announcing the agenda.
What is the purpose of meeting called to order/opening?
The purpose of a meeting called to order/opening is to establish order and officially begin the proceedings of the meeting.
What information must be reported on meeting called to order/opening?
The information reported on a meeting called to order/opening typically includes the date, time, location, and agenda of the meeting.
